Description
The UGREEN US122 (10374) USB Type-A Male to USB Type-B Male 10 Meter Active Printer Cable is an extended, commercial-grade peripheral data cord engineered to connect computers or local servers to hardware terminals like printers, scanners, and plotters over long distances. Under standard physics, unamplified USB 2.0 digital signals begin to suffer from attenuation and packet loss past a 5-meter threshold. To override this hardware bottleneck, this specialized 10-meter (approx. 33 feet) cable features a built-in active signal booster chipset integrated directly into the line. This bus-powered IC regenerates and amplifies the data packets, ensuring a stable, lag-free connection across large footprints.
The primary operational benefit of this active architecture is its ability to route clean data across large office layouts, multi-tier point-of-sale (POS) checkout stations, or industrial workshop floors without relying on flaky wireless setups or complex network print servers. To protect the integrity of the data stream crossing this long distance, the cable is engineered with premium multi-layer shielding and pure copper conductors. This heavy-duty shielding insulates the signal from external electromagnetic and radio frequency noise (EMI/RFI) common in high-density electronic workspaces.
